Historical Context and Market Dynamics

Traditionally, Greece’s media consumption involved terrestrial broadcasting and physical entertainment media. However, globalization and digital penetration—now reaching over 70% internet coverage—have fostered a fertile environment for mobile and online gaming. According to recent reports, the Greek gaming market is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 9.3% through 2027, driven largely by increased smartphone adoption and platforms catering to local demographics.

Local Initiatives and Industry Growth

Supportive infrastructure and government initiatives have played a pivotal role. For instance, local startups are receiving funding and mentorship, encouraging the development of culturally resonant gaming content. Notably, many Greek developers focus on integrating traditional elements—like mythology and historical narratives—into their titles, creating a distinctive voice in the global market.

Future Outlook: Challenges and Opportunities

Despite positive momentum, the Greek gaming industry faces hurdles—such as limited access to funding for indie developers, regulatory frameworks, and infrastructural challenges in rural areas. Nonetheless, the increasing integration of blockchain technology and esports presents new avenues for growth.

Industry experts emphasize the importance of leveraging local cultural elements, combined with global technological advancements, to position Greece as a boutique but influential player in the international gaming community.
